DescribeWorkspaceAssociations
Describes the associations betweens applications and the specified WorkSpace.
Request Syntax
{
   "AssociatedResourceTypes": [ "string" ],
   "WorkspaceId": "string"
}Request Parameters
The request accepts the following data in JSON format.
- AssociatedResourceTypes
- 
               The resource types of the associated resources. Type: Array of strings Valid Values: APPLICATIONRequired: Yes 
- WorkspaceId
- 
               The identifier of the WorkSpace. Type: String Pattern: ^ws-[0-9a-z]{8,63}$Required: Yes 
Response Syntax
{
   "Associations": [ 
      { 
         "AssociatedResourceId": "string",
         "AssociatedResourceType": "string",
         "Created": number,
         "LastUpdatedTime": number,
         "State": "string",
         "StateReason": { 
            "ErrorCode": "string",
            "ErrorMessage": "string"
         },
         "WorkspaceId": "string"
      }
   ]
}Response Elements
If the action is successful, the service sends back an HTTP 200 response.
The following data is returned in JSON format by the service.
- Associations
- 
               List of information about the specified associations. Type: Array of WorkspaceResourceAssociation objects 
Errors
For information about the errors that are common to all actions, see Common Errors.
- AccessDeniedException
- 
               The user is not authorized to access a resource. HTTP Status Code: 400 
- InvalidParameterValuesException
- 
               One or more parameter values are not valid. - message
- 
                        The exception error message. 
 HTTP Status Code: 400 
- OperationNotSupportedException
- 
               This operation is not supported. - message
- 
                        The exception error message. 
- reason
- 
                        The exception error reason. 
 HTTP Status Code: 400 
- ResourceNotFoundException
- 
               The resource could not be found. - message
- 
                        The resource could not be found. 
- ResourceId
- 
                        The ID of the resource that could not be found. 
 HTTP Status Code: 400
